What Is the Cost of Living Near Silver Spring?

Understanding the cost of living near Silver Spring is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Superior Transmissions.
Silver Spring's Cost of Living Index is approximately 128.7 (28.7% more expensive than US average; 13.9% more than MD average). Inner Montgomery County suburb bordering DC, high housing costs, vibrant downtown. Ride On bus, Metro Red Line. When planning your budget based on a salary from Superior Transmissions,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,800 - $2,700+ A significant portion of Superior Transmissions sal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$150 - $250 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$45 (Ride On pass, Metro extra)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$460 - $680 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$450 - $800+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$410 - $760+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,315 - $5,195+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
